Dubai Culture and Arts Authority launched

HH Sheikh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, vice president and prime minister of the UAE and ruler of Dubai, today issued a decree establishing the Dubai Culture and Arts Authority.

He also issued another decree appointing HH Sheikh Mayed bin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um as Chairman of Culture and Arts Authority, and Dr Omar bin Sulaiman as member of the board and managing director in Charge.

The authority has been mandated with creating a culture and Arts infrastructure that positions Dubai as a vibrant, global city helping to shape 21st Century culture and arts in the region and the world. It will be at the forefront of the culture strategy, set out by Sheikh Mohammed as part of the overall Dubai Strategy 2015.

Dr Omar Bin Sulaiman, Board Member and Managing Director in Charge of the Dubai Culture and Arts Authority said "The Authority will build on Dubai's status as one of the most multicultural cities in the world, where East meets West, and will actively encourage Dubai's community that embraces over 200 nationalities living and working together in harmony to contribute to the culture and heritage renaissance." He added that the launch of the Dubai Culture and Arts Authority reflects Sheikh Mohammed's belief that culture and arts can make a major contribution to the social development of Dubai and the UAE. Building bridges and celebrating cultures from around the region and the world are key elements of Sheikh Mohammed's culture and heritage vision.

Sulaiman noted as developing and delivering outstanding international, regional and local cultural programming, the Culture and Arts Authority will support local and home grown talent and productions. It will work to preserve and promote local Emirati heritage, while, at the same time attracting the world's leading artists and cultural thinkers to become part of Dubai's modern renaissance. It will also promote and export Dubai's arts and culture to the region and the world.

The board of directors consists of Mohammed Al Murr, vice chairman, Dr Omar bin Sulaiman as member of the board and managing director in Charge, and members of Sheikh Majed Jaber Hamoud Al Sabah; HE Reem Ibrahim Al Hashemi, Paulo Coelho, Kito Mark Antonio De Boer, Omar Obaid Ghubash, Abdul Hameed Mohammed Juma, Yasser Saeed Hareb, Dr Aisha Khalifa Bulkhair, Dr Lamees Hamdan Al Shamsi, Shamsa Majed Quraiban, and Saeb Eigner.

The authority will develop a world-class arts and cultural infrastructure in Dubai. It will focus on creating an environment for creativity and innovation in visual arts, theatre, music, literature, poetry and various other arts. Several new cultural, arts and heritage entities will be created to drive innovative programs in all culture areas by working directly with leading global partners, arts organisations and Dubai's multicultural communities, will also be established.

A key part of the authority's work will be to incorporate arts and culture into the daily lifestyle of Dubai and use the arts to create synergies between Dubai's different cultures and to build a strong, unique cultural identity for all of Dubai. (WAM)
